逻辑与计算机设计基础复习关键:数字系统,信息编码,组合逻辑
需积分: 16 33 浏览量
更新于2024-09-09
收藏 60KB DOC 举报
"逻辑与计算机设计基础学习复习要点"
在学习《逻辑与计算机设计基础》这门课程时,我们需要掌握以下几个核心知识点:
第一章 数字计算机与信息
1. 数字系统:这一部分主要介绍数字信号的基本概念,以及数字系统在计算机中的应用。数字系统基于数字信号进行信息处理,而数字信号是离散的、不连续的电信号。
2. 计算机内信息表示法:理解如何在计算机内部存储和处理信息,包括浮点数、整数、字符等不同类型的表示方式。
3. 数制:深入学习各种进位计数制,如十进制、二进制、十六进制和八进制,以及它们之间的转换方法。
4. 编码:掌握编码的基本概念,了解如何用二进制表示带符号的数值,如原码、反码、补码。同时,学习十进制数的二进制编码(BCD码)以及字符编码,如ASCII码,这是计算机内部处理文本的基础。
5. 各种信息的编码:不仅限于数值和字符,还包括图像、声音等各种类型的信息编码。
第二章 组合逻辑电路
1. 布尔代数:布尔代数是组合逻辑电路的基础,它涉及变量、真值、逻辑运算等概念,以及二值逻辑的表示。
2. 基本逻辑门:包括与门、或门、非门等,以及它们的电路符号和逻辑特性。
3. 逻辑函数的化简:学习如何使用布尔代数的定律简化逻辑表达式,如代入规则、分配律、反演定律等,以及卡诺图法。
4. 逻辑电路的表示形式:如真值表、逻辑表达式、波形图、卡诺图和电路图,了解它们之间的转换。
5. 高阻态输出和特殊门类型:如三态门、集电极开路(OC)门,理解线与的概念及其应用。
第三章 组合逻辑设计
1. 组合逻辑电路的定义和分类:了解组合逻辑电路与时序逻辑电路的区别。
2. 模块化和层次设计:在设计复杂的逻辑电路时,采用模块化设计可以提高效率和可读性。
3. 逻辑门的参数:了解扇入、扇出、噪音容限、传输延迟、功耗等关键参数。
4. 正逻辑与负逻辑:理解这两种逻辑表示方式及其在电路设计中的应用。
5. 三态门的使用和总线:三态门用于实现总线通信,理解其工作原理和控制方式。
6. 信号系统延时和时钟边沿:这些因素对电路性能至关重要,特别是同步系统中。
7. 组合逻辑电路的分析与设计方法:学习如何分析现有电路和设计新电路。
8. 可编程逻辑器件:了解ROM、PAL、PLA、CPLD、FPGA以及查找表(LUT)等技术,它们在现代数字系统设计中的作用。
第四章 组合函数及相应电路
1. 函数模块和实现技术:学习如何将逻辑函数转换为实际电路,如译码器、编码器、数据选择器、数据分配器、数据比较器和奇偶校验器等。
2. 逻辑功能芯片:掌握这些常用电路的功能和使用方法。
3. 通过各种技术实现组合函数:如使用译码器、多路复用器、ROMs、PLAs和PALs等。
4. 使能信号:理解EN和OE信号在控制逻辑电路工作状态中的作用。
第五章 算术函数及相应电路
1. 调用结构:探讨组合电路在执行算术运算时的结构。
2. 算术逻辑单元(ALU):ALU是计算机中执行算术和逻辑运算的核心组件,学习其工作原理和设计方法。
3. 其他算术电路:例如加法器、减法器、乘法器和除法器,它们在数字计算中的应用。
这些知识点构成了逻辑与计算机设计基础的基石,理解和掌握这些内容对于深入学习计算机硬件、数字电子学以及计算机系统设计至关重要。通过理论学习与实践操作相结合,能够更好地掌握这门课程的精髓。
2021-12-17 上传
2023-07-16 上传
2023-05-19 上传
2023-07-09 上传
2023-09-19 上传
2023-07-17 上传
2024-10-25 上传
zmj1316
- 粉丝: 0
- 资源: 4
最新资源
- Raspberry Pi OpenCL驱动程序安装与QEMU仿真指南
- Apache RocketMQ Go客户端:全面支持与消息处理功能
- WStage平台:无线传感器网络阶段数据交互技术
- 基于Java SpringBoot和微信小程序的ssm智能仓储系统开发
- CorrectMe项目:自动更正与建议API的开发与应用
- IdeaBiz请求处理程序JAVA:自动化API调用与令牌管理
- 墨西哥面包店研讨会:介绍关键业绩指标(KPI)与评估标准
- 2014年Android音乐播放器源码学习分享
- CleverRecyclerView扩展库:滑动效果与特性增强
- 利用Python和SURF特征识别斑点猫图像
- Wurpr开源PHP MySQL包装器:安全易用且高效
- Scratch少儿编程:Kanon妹系闹钟音效素材包
- 食品分享社交应用的开发教程与功能介绍
- Cookies by lfj.io: 浏览数据智能管理与同步工具
- 掌握SSH框架与SpringMVC Hibernate集成教程
- C语言实现FFT算法及互相关性能优化指南